Weather in January

January, like December, is another subzero cold winter month in Magnor, Norway, with an average temperature fluctuating between -2°C (28.4°F) and -6.2°C (20.8°F).

Temperature

January brings the lowest temperatures, with an average high of -2°C (28.4°F) and an average low of -6.2°C (20.8°F).

Humidity

In Magnor, the average relative humidity in January is 91%.

Rainfall

In Magnor, in January, it is raining for 5.8 days, with typically 35mm (1.38") of accumulated precipitation. In Magnor, Norway, during the entire year, the rain falls for 153.5 days and collects up to 549mm (21.61") of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Magnor are January through May, October through December. In Magnor, Norway, in January, snow falls for 13.7 days, with typically accumulated 186mm (7.32") of snow. Throughout the year, in Magnor, there are 66.1 snowfall days, and 882mm (34.72") of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January is 6h and 53min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 09:12 and sunset at 15:16. On the last day of January, in Magnor, sunrise is at 08:27 and sunset at 16:21 CET.

Sunshine

In January, the average sunshine is 3.1h.

UV index

In January, the average daily maximum UV index is 2.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a minimal health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
